Lehigh welcomes St. Joseph's on Tuesday

BETHLEHEM, Pa. - After winning a pair of tough road contests last week, Lehigh returns home on Tuesday evening to take on Atlantic-10 member St. Joseph’s at Stabler Arena. The Mountain Hawks downed Dartmouth on Saturday, 73-60 in New Hampshire for their third straight road win. Junior Zahir Carrington led the way with his second career double-double (15 points, 14 rebounds), while John Gourlay added a season-best eight points, and Prentice Small handed out a career-high nine assists. The win put the finishing touches on the most successful November Lehigh has had since the inception of Patriot League play in 1990. St. Joseph’s spent last week in Hawaii, where the Hawks played a trio of games versus Texas, Indiana, and Alabama at the EA Sports Maui Invitational. A 2007 NCAA Tournament participant, St. Joseph’s will be playing its fifth straight game away from home on Tuesday evening.
Lehigh has swatted six shots in each of its last two games, led by Phil Anderson’s career-high four blocks at Dartmouth. The 12 blocks is Lehigh’s highest two-game total since registering 15 blocked shots in back-to-back games last season against Quinnipiac (10) and Central Connecticut State (5).
The Mountain Hawks have scored 30 points in the last two minutes of games this season, compared to 21 points by their opponents. During that time Lehigh has sank 20-of-27 free throw attempts, while its opponents have shot just 5-for-12 at the charity stripe.
